How to fix a cable that's been cut in half?
So my Magsafe conector got sliced in half around 3 inches from the end that connects to the computer. I've watched videos of the head being fixed but is there any way to solder the cable halfway?

Yes it can. I replaced the cabling on my charger by cutting the cord close to the damage (from my cats) and adding the new cord from there - rather than opening up the charger.
The cord has a shielded inner set of wires which is positive (?) with the negative (?) running around the outside. Separate the two, solder them up to the other end of the cable, insulate with electrical tape and you're done.
